Hundred And fifty five

Derek

The council chamber emptied slowly, the weight of my words still lingering in the air like a heavy storm cloud. My mind raced as I paced the room, Giovanni standing beside me, his presence a silent pillar of support.

King Worden had betrayed us. Not only had he conspired with rogues, but he had also directly ordered the execution of my nephew.

A man I once called an ally.

A man who knew the inner workings of Mallory’s defenses.
